What is artificial intelligence in web development and design?
AI is the technology that uses tools, such as machine learning, to implement web development and design trends and tasks. You can complete web design projects on your own

Despite their youth, there are already many publicly available website building platforms. They are capable of automatically creating websites for users and include tools like Wix ADI, TheGrid, and Adobe Sensei.

How the combination of AI and UX can improve web development and design
Although AI cannot match human skills at this point, there are several ways through which it can transform web development and design:
Automation and autogeneration of code. AI-based web development tools can help programmers automate a wide range of basic tasks, thereby increasing their work efficiency. They update database records, add new records, predict code to solve specific problems, and use the predictions to select the most appropriate solution.
Improving user experience with chatbots. More and more websites are adopting chatbots to improve UX.
